Why this matters in The Waco
The 21st Century Road to Housing Act's impact on Waco 's housing market will be closely watched, particularly in areas where affordable housing options are scarce. As the city continues to grow, the demand for affordable homes has increased, making it challenging for first-time buyers to enter the market. Local realtors like Daniela Rodriguez play a crucial role in guiding these buyers through the process, and their expertise will be essential in navigating the changes brought about by the new law. The law's emphasis on community banks and expanded lending options could lead to more collaborations between local financial institutions and organizations that support affordable housing, such as NeighborWorks. As the market adjusts to the new law, Waco residents can expect to see more targeted initiatives and resources aimed at making homeownership more accessible, which could have a positive impact on the city's economic development and community growth.
